Rnb music on the radio in British Virgin Islands

R&B music has a considerable following in the British Virgin Islands, and it is ultimately due to the influence of African American music. The genre is popular for its rhythm and blues, soulful melodies, and funky beats. Some of the most popular R&B artists in the British Virgin Islands include Gazaman, who is known for his hits "Show You Love" and "Dibby Dibby Sound." Another R&B artist making waves in the British Virgin Islands music scene is R. City. The duo is originally from St. Thomas but has achieved global popularity thanks to their collaborations with some of the biggest names in the music industry, including Rihanna, Nicki Minaj, and Adam Levine from Maroon 5. Their hit song, "Locked Away," topped charts in many countries including the British Virgin Islands. Several radio stations play R&B genre music in the British Virgin Islands, providing locals and tourists with a steady stream of chart-topping hits. One such radio station is ZROD 103.7 FM, which broadcasts a mix of hip hop, R&B, and reggae. Another popular R&B station is Hitz 92 FM, which plays popular upbeat and smooth R&B tracks.
